From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Robert =?utf-8?Q?Plu=C4=ADm?= Newsgroups: gmane.emacs.bugs Subject: bug#51733: 27.1; Detect impossible email addresses better Date: Wed, 19 Jan 2022 14:39:20 +0100 Message-ID: <87czknonef.fsf@gmail.com> References: <87czn8etuz.7.fsf@jidanni.org> <87sftm5lxc.fsf@gnus.org> <835yqiwa87.fsf@gnu.org> <87ee565l4d.fsf@gnus.org> <875yqi5kk7.fsf@gnus.org> <83zgnuuucu.fsf@gnu.org> <83r196uqni.fsf@gnu.org> <87sftm3ye5.fsf@gnus.org> <87iluh4ety.fsf@gnus.org> <87ee55474p.fsf@gnus.org> <87a6ft46mr.fsf@gnus.org> <874k6146ay.fsf@gnus.org> <87zgnt2qz9.fsf@gnus.org> <87v8yh2ot4.fsf@gnus.org> <87r1952omd.fsf@gnus.org> <831r14vq70.fsf@gnu.org> <87tue0nkrx.fsf@gmail.com> <8335lkszzc.fsf@gnu.org> <87h79zoppr.fsf@gmail.com> <83v8yfswzd.fsf@gnu.org> <874k5zdgjj.fsf@gnus.org>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="40138"; mail-complaints-to="usenet@ciao.gmane.io" Cc: 51733@debbugs.gnu.org To: Lars Ingebrigtsen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Wed Jan 19 14:56:23 2022 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nABRn-000AGq-7G for geb-bug-gnu-emacs@m.gmane-mx.org; Wed, 19 Jan 2022 14:56:23 +0100 Original-Received: from localhost ([::1]:45712 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nABRm-0007Jf-AA for geb-bug-gnu-emacs@m.gmane-mx.org; Wed, 19 Jan 2022 08:56:22 -0500 Original-Received: from eggs.gnu.org ([209.51.188.92]:32854)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nABC0-0008Pb-3j for bug-gnu-emacs@gnu.org; Wed, 19 Jan 2022 08:40:04 -0500 Original-Received: from debbugs.gnu.org ([209.51.188.43]:60055)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1nABBz-0002gO-Jn for bug-gnu-emacs@gnu.org; Wed, 19 Jan 2022 08:40:03 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1nABBz-000873-3e; Wed, 19 Jan 2022 08:40:03 -0500 X-Loop: help-debbugs@gnu.org Resent-From: Robert =?utf-8?Q?Plu=C4=ADm?=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org, bugs@gnus.org Resent-Date: Wed, 19 Jan 2022 13:40:03 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 51733 X-GNU-PR-Package: emacs,gnus Original-Received: via spool by 51733-submit@debbugs.gnu.org id=B51733.164259956931095 (code B ref 51733); Wed, 19 Jan 2022 13:40:03 +0000 Original-Received: (at 51733) by debbugs.gnu.org; 19 Jan 2022 13:39:29 +0000 Original-Received: from localhost ([127.0.0.1]:52949 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nABBR-00085T-0o for submit@debbugs.gnu.org; Wed, 19 Jan 2022 08:39:29 -0500 Original-Received: from mail-ed1-f50.google.com ([209.85.208.50]:41669)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nABBP-000858-DS for 51733@debbugs.gnu.org; Wed, 19 Jan 2022 08:39:27 -0500 Original-Received: by mail-ed1-f50.google.com with SMTP id j2so11633829edj.8 for <51733@debbugs.gnu.org>; Wed, 19 Jan 2022 05:39:27 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:references:date:in-reply-to:message-id :mime-version:content-transfer-encoding; bh=3qWiHB9ZmRwzyW83yxA4rD1VjzZCeurD753fPpoakuE=; b=YQe0f2w/NOplJB2qJURpVQhVrXxSjMrV6ShM6nEqL37v0CIsch/NbrcaPIFlvQuY4y tOc+X9I3HflGBAr8WH3vxrEs5lW8X5AdOeuB5m4uM0hblapCE4uBaAmEwrqNgjW34U25 72+SQF2U9dx0jvLKpO9L0SCcnehpltFx0OqkN3AxLu9u4jgsZk/nLhfldgeGtyCV9P3i Jfx2bTLp+gPMcSbrsUXThnI6jPr7c/4It8zMQkdpZy2rwWQtIsJhJbGNMFlAnW+/ajyW bTiisknmJwgugcHyb69y94CDJ2Teczc+hifQ8SiJ6xzNqDmlDh7mw7HOB9S7Kknzu1Jp JNyQ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:references:date:in-reply-to :message-id:mime-version:content-transfer-encoding; bh=3qWiHB9ZmRwzyW83yxA4rD1VjzZCeurD753fPpoakuE=; b=W8N7SEhS5WpRd+rXdSUTEugxZh2NCsSV17wFxsp0UmBPtn3Zh53fPrI+HC+rb0UxS0 BaAd8M5vMwN0cYhz/tJneuVPyt0d7P3FN4v14tXDxsqJCPYF8e6rw2T+gMnMpPTGnCSL UMonUgjAqnbUv/TLVkolqtVgqVEWWoC9cpuREyLoXzKEnVBIPvMqKWF73OBR15E5BvQU tPGuZ5DtmyPSQ6bRyDP4wCGDC8a1ZfIQyUF4saibSHwioVTlhhYB7j8vEfE0WDNKh/W9 pcWKgW+lMGzsi2h7dVXARqkXm9nq533KaQ0YewVL7V31gVFNZYJGt0Wm5LsIkWYa//oT aedQ== X-Gm-Message-State: AOAM533ajppHqwAKSE6XKlRGS81tRG+37KgAzbA50iWDXPn6WfmbSyAG ecYWgQzWNGt0pqo+Y4+ao1Q3aHIFVDE= X-Google-Smtp-Source: ABdhPJwE39LpuWhXovOykzfuiF9EdTAnsZcFB2BVmKPmaYjRXphBqO3f+WH6g+Xt/h8UkRVDGX2lpQ== X-Received: by 2002:a05:600c:4f8c:: with SMTP id n12mr3556996wmq.129.1642599561227; Wed, 19 Jan 2022 05:39:21 -0800 (PST) Original-Received: from rltb ([2a01:e0a:3f3:fb50:5497:eb2c:1716:483e]) by smtp.gmail.com with ESMTPSA id p10sm9651298wrr.10.2022.01.19.05.39.20 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 19 Jan 2022 05:39:20 -0800 (PST) In-Reply-To: <874k5zdgjj.fsf@gnus.org> (Lars Ingebrigtsen's message of "Wed, 19 Jan 2022 14:02:56 +0100") X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:224582 Archived-At: >>>>> On Wed, 19 Jan 2022 14:02:56 +0100, Lars Ingebrigtsen said: Lars> Eli Zaretskii writes: >> Is that expectation reasonable? I can show you many email addresses >> that violate that. Lars> It depends on what you mean. There are no valid email addresses = that Lars> have non-ASCII name parts -- when we're talking wire format (RFC2= 047 Lars> etc), which is what that function is parsing. I can=CA=BCt recall if this is allowed by the standards or not offhand, but as you=CA=BCre probably well aware, the major email providers allow you to use UTF-8 characters directly in the display name of email adresses, without using RFC 2047 encoding. In fact, the last time I did any testing of this, Gmail *replaced* RFC 2047 encoded non-ASCII characters with their UTF-8 encoding. Robert --=20